My wife and I are considering the purchase of a 2013 C-Max SEL with the 302A package, and I am hoping some of the posters on this excellent forum could share their thoughts with us to help decide between a new or a used car. A local used-car dealer has one in that configuration with 14K miles; it appears to be in excellent condition and has a sticker of 23k (I'm assuming that we can negotiate them down a bit, so let's say 22.5K). I have checked the VIN, and that car has a build date of November 2012. Alternatively, we have an internet quote from a Ford dealer for a new C-Max SEL with the 302A package for 27K. 

     

    My initial inclination is to buy the second-hand car. It is quite a bit cheaper, and we would avoid the big, first-year depreciation hit. OTOH, I am concerned about buying a C-Max with a build date of 11/12 owing to the problems people have experienced with MYFT and the 12 v battery and the possibility that we might be buying a problem car. Any thoughts would be greatly appreciated, but I am especially interested to get a sense of whether or not the 12 v and MYFT problems have been resolved.
